Abstract
We give a characterization for a (2, 0)-geodesic affine immersion to an affine space by using its index of relative nullity. Especially, we prove a cylinder theorem for such a hypersurface. We also show a cylinder theorem for a (2, 0)-geodesic isometric immersion from a Kähler manifold and anti-Kähler manifold as a corollary.
